Yaxia Yuan is a scholar working on Molecular Biology, Computational Theory and Mathematics and Organic Chemistry. According to data from OpenAlex, Yaxia Yuan has authored 56 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 39 papers in Molecular Biology, 13 papers in Computational Theory and Mathematics and 12 papers in Organic Chemistry. Recurrent topics in Yaxia Yuan’s work include Computational Drug Discovery Methods (13 papers), HIV Research and Treatment (11 papers) and HIV/AIDS drug development and treatment (11 papers). Yaxia Yuan is often cited by papers focused on Computational Drug Discovery Methods (13 papers), HIV Research and Treatment (11 papers) and HIV/AIDS drug development and treatment (11 papers). Yaxia Yuan collaborates with scholars based in United States, China and Finland. Yaxia Yuan's co-authors include Jianfeng Pei, Luhua Lai, Chang‐Guo Zhan, Daohong Zhou, Guangrong Zheng, Xuan Zhang, Sajid Khan, Jun Zhu, Yonghan He and Xingui Liu and has published in prestigious journals such as Nucleic Acids Research, Nature Communications and Blood.
